Packages
relayburn@2.8.5(tag:relayburn-v2.8.5)@relayburn/sdk@2.8.5(tag:sdk-v2.8.5)@relayburn/mcp@2.8.5(tag:mcp-v2.8.5)@relayburn/cli-darwin-arm64@2.8.5(tag:cli-darwin-arm64-v2.8.5)@relayburn/cli-darwin-x64@2.8.5(tag:cli-darwin-x64-v2.8.5)@relayburn/cli-linux-arm64-gnu@2.8.5(tag:cli-linux-arm64-gnu-v2.8.5)@relayburn/cli-linux-x64-gnu@2.8.5(tag:cli-linux-x64-gnu-v2.8.5)@relayburn/sdk-darwin-arm64@2.8.5(tag:sdk-darwin-arm64-v2.8.5)@relayburn/sdk-darwin-x64@2.8.5(tag:sdk-darwin-x64-v2.8.5)@relayburn/sdk-linux-arm64-gnu@2.8.5(tag:sdk-linux-arm64-gnu-v2.8.5)@relayburn/sdk-linux-x64-gnu@2.8.5(tag:sdk-linux-x64-gnu-v2.8.5)
Crates
relayburn-sdk@2.8.5(tag:relayburn-sdk-v2.8.5) — https://crates.io/crates/relayburn-sdk/2.8.5relayburn-cli@2.8.5(tag:relayburn-cli-v2.8.5) — https://crates.io/crates/relayburn-cli/2.8.5
Release Notes
Changed
relayburn-sdk: ingest verbs are now synchronous; async callers should
run them viatokio::task::spawn_blocking.relayburn-sdk: lower per-record allocations in reader hashing, tool-result
sizing, relationship dedup, and project resolution. Cuts overhead during
large session imports and concurrentresolve_projectcalls.relayburn-sdk:parse_claude_sessionnow delegates to the incremental
parser withstart_offset = 0, dropping the duplicateParseState
codepath. Behavior is unchanged — trailing in-progress turns and final
JSON lines lacking a trailing newline still surface in the single-shot
output.
Removed
relayburn-sdk: removedrun_ingest_tick.